Helicobacter pylori, also known as H. pylori, is a type of bacteria that can infect the stomach and digestive tract. It is estimated that around 50% of the global population carries this bacterium, although not everyone infected will experience symptoms. However, for those who do develop symptoms, such as stomach ulcers or gastritis, testing for H. pylori is crucial for diagnosis and treatment.
The Helicobacter pylori bacteria test is a diagnostic procedure used to detect the presence of the H. pylori bacteria in the stomach. There are several methods available to test for this bacterium, each with its own advantages and limitations. 2. **Types of H. pylori Tests**
There are several methods available to test for the presence of H. pylori in the stomach. These tests can be broadly categorized into invasive and non-invasive tests. Invasive tests involve obtaining a tissue sample from the stomach, while non-invasive tests can be done using breath, blood, or stool samples.
– **Endoscopy with Biopsy**: This is considered the gold standard for diagnosing H. pylori infection. During an endoscopy, a thin, flexible tube with a camera is inserted through the mouth to visualize the stomach lining. A small tissue sample (biopsy) is taken for analysis in the laboratory.
– **Urea Breath Test**: This non-invasive test involves the patient drinking a urea solution containing a special carbon molecule. If H. pylori is present in the stomach, it will break down the urea and release the labeled carbon, which can be detected in the breath sample.
– **Stool Antigen Test**: This test looks for H. pylori antigens (proteins) in a stool sample. It is a non-invasive alternative to endoscopy and can be used to monitor treatment success after taking antibiotics to eliminate the bacteria.
– **Blood Antibody Test**: This test checks for the presence of antibodies in the blood that the immune system produces in response to H. pylori infection. While it can confirm past exposure to the bacteria, it is not as reliable for detecting current infection.
3. **What to Expect During the Testing Process**
The specific steps involved in the H. pylori testing process will vary depending on the type of test being performed. For example, if you are undergoing an endoscopy with biopsy, you will need to fast for a certain period before the procedure and may be sedated to minimize discomfort during the examination.
On the other hand, non-invasive tests like the urea breath test or stool antigen test are relatively simple and can be done in a clinic or lab setting. Patients may be asked to avoid certain medications or substances before these tests to ensure accurate results.
Regardless of the testing method, it is essential to follow your healthcare provider’s instructions and inform them of any allergies, medical conditions, or medications you are taking. Results from H. pylori tests are typically available within a few days to a week, depending on the type of test performed and the testing facility’s processing time.
4. **Treatment for H. pylori Infection**
If you are diagnosed with an H. pylori infection, treatment usually involves a combination of antibiotics and acid-suppressing medications. The goal of treatment is to eradicate the bacteria and promote healing of any associated ulcers or inflammation. It is essential to complete the full course of antibiotics as prescribed by your healthcare provider to prevent recurrence of the infection.
Once treatment is completed, follow-up testing may be recommended to confirm that the bacteria have been successfully eradicated. This usually involves a non-invasive test like the urea breath test or stool antigen test.
